Why Small Businesses Need CRM Software

Customer Relationship Management (CRM) tools are no longer just for large enterprises. In fact, small businesses benefit the most from organized, data-driven customer interactions. A solid CRM helps streamline sales, improve customer service, and boost marketing efficiency—all critical for growth.
Boosting Sales Efficiency
One of the primary reasons small businesses adopt CRM software is to enhance their sales process. With a CRM, sales teams can track leads, manage pipelines, and automate follow-ups. This reduces manual work and ensures no opportunity slips through the cracks.
- Automated lead tracking saves time and reduces human error.
- Visual sales pipelines help identify bottlenecks.
- Task reminders keep your team on schedule.
According to Salesforce, companies using CRM see a 29% increase in sales performance on average.
Improving Customer Retention
Acquiring a new customer can cost five times more than retaining an existing one. A CRM helps you maintain consistent communication, track customer history, and deliver personalized service. This builds trust and loyalty over time.
- Centralized customer data allows for faster response times.
- Interaction logs help avoid repetitive questions.
- Feedback tracking enables continuous improvement.

1. HubSpot CRM
HubSpot CRM is widely regarded as the gold standard for free CRM software. It’s intuitive, feature-packed, and integrates seamlessly with other tools in the HubSpot ecosystem.
- Unlimited contacts and deals
- Email tracking and scheduling
- Live chat and meeting scheduling
- Customizable dashboard and reports
One standout feature is its email sync, which automatically logs interactions with contacts. This is a game-changer for small teams managing high volumes of communication. Learn more at HubSpot’s official site.
“HubSpot CRM is the only free tool I’ve used that feels premium.” — Verified User, G2
2. Zoho CRM
Zoho CRM offers a powerful free plan for up to three users. It’s ideal for small sales teams that need automation and workflow customization without paying a dime.
- Lead and contact management
- Workflow automation rules
- Sales forecasting tools
- Mobile app with offline access
Zoho also integrates with over 40 business apps, including Gmail, Outlook, and QuickBooks. Their free plan includes 10MB of storage per user, which is sufficient for most small businesses. Visit Zoho CRM to get started.
3. Freshsales (by Freshworks)
Freshsales offers a clean interface and AI-powered insights even in its free tier. It’s perfect for startups that want smart sales tools without complexity.
- AI-based lead scoring
- Visual deal pipeline
- Email and phone integration
- Activity reminders and task management
The free version supports up to 10 users and includes unlimited contacts and accounts. Its AI assistant, Freddy, helps prioritize leads based on engagement—ideal for time-strapped entrepreneurs. Explore it at Freshworks CRM.
4. Bitrix24
Bitrix24 is more than just a CRM—it’s a full business suite. The free plan includes CRM, project management, telephony, and collaboration tools.
- Unlimited contacts and deals
- Free internal phone system (VoIP)
- Task and document management
- 5GB of free cloud storage
While the interface can feel overwhelming at first, Bitrix24 is incredibly powerful for teams that want an all-in-one solution. It supports up to 12 users on the free plan. Check it out at Bitrix24.
5. Insightly
Insightly stands out for its project and contact management integration. It’s ideal for service-based businesses like consultants, contractors, and agencies.
- Project and task tracking
- Relationship linking (e.g., contact to project)
- Email integration and calendar sync
- Basic reporting and dashboards
The free plan supports up to two users and includes 2,500 contacts. While limited in user count, it’s excellent for solopreneurs or small partnerships. Learn more at Insightly.
6. Agile CRM
Agile CRM combines sales, marketing, and service tools in one platform. Its free plan is feature-rich but limited to 10 users and 1,000 contacts.
- Marketing automation (email campaigns)
- Web tracking and pop-ups
- Call and email logging
- Task and event management
One downside: the free plan includes Agile branding on emails. Still, it’s a solid choice for startups testing automation. Visit Agile CRM to sign up.
7. Capsule CRM
Capsule CRM is minimalist and user-friendly, perfect for businesses that want simplicity without sacrificing core functionality.
- Easy contact and sales tracking
- Task and calendar management
- Integration with Google Workspace and Mailchimp
- No user limit on the free plan
The free version supports up to 250 contacts, which suits very small teams or early-stage startups. While limited in scale, it’s intuitive and fast to set up. Explore it at Capsule CRM.

Pricing and Upgrade Options
While all these platforms offer free plans, understanding their paid tiers is crucial for long-term planning. Most charge per user per month, starting around $10–$25.
- HubSpot: Paid plans start at $18/month for Sales Hub.
- Zoho CRM: Standard plan at $14/user/month.
- Freshsales: Growth plan at $15/user/month.
- Bitrix24: Paid plans start at $49/month for 5 users.
- Insightly: Pro plan at $29/user/month.
- Agile CRM: Starter plan at $14.99/user/month.
- Capsule: Premium plan at $18/user/month.
Always check for annual billing discounts and free trials before upgrading.
Integration Capabilities of Free CRM Tools
A CRM is only as powerful as the tools it connects with. The best free CRM software for small business integrates with email, calendars, marketing platforms, and productivity apps.
Email and Calendar Sync
Seamless integration with Gmail and Outlook is non-negotiable. The top CRMs automatically log emails, schedule meetings, and sync calendars.
- HubSpot and Zoho offer two-way sync with Gmail and Outlook.
- Freshsales includes built-in email templates and tracking.
- Bitrix24 has a full email client within the platform.
These integrations eliminate double data entry and keep your communication history intact.
Marketing and Productivity Tools
Many free CRMs connect with tools like Mailchimp, Slack, Google Drive, and Zoom. This creates a unified workspace.
- Insightly integrates with Mailchimp for email campaigns.
- Agile CRM supports Facebook and Google Ads tracking.
- Capsule works with Google Workspace and Zapier.
Using Zapier, you can automate workflows between apps, even on free plans.
User Experience and Mobile Accessibility
A CRM should be easy to use and accessible on the go. Poor UX leads to low adoption, which defeats the purpose of having a CRM.
Interface Design and Ease of Use
The best platforms prioritize clean design and intuitive navigation. HubSpot and Capsule excel here with drag-and-drop interfaces and minimal learning curves.
- HubSpot uses a modern, dashboard-first approach.
- Zoho offers customization but can feel cluttered.
- Freshsales has a sleek, visual pipeline layout.
For non-technical users, simplicity is key. Avoid platforms with steep learning curves unless you have dedicated training time.
Mobile App Performance
Mobile access is essential for field sales teams and remote workers. All top CRMs offer iOS and Android apps.
- HubSpot’s mobile app includes voice-to-text notes and offline access.
- Zoho CRM allows offline data entry and syncing.
- Bitrix24 includes a built-in phone system on mobile.
Test the mobile app before committing—some free versions limit functionality on mobile.
Security and Data Privacy in Free CRM Platforms
Just because a CRM is free doesn’t mean it should compromise your data. Security is critical, especially when handling customer information.
Data Encryption and Compliance
The best free CRM software for small business free ensures data is encrypted in transit and at rest. Look for compliance with GDPR, CCPA, and SOC 2 standards.
- HubSpot and Zoho are GDPR-compliant and offer data export tools.
- Freshsales uses SSL/TLS encryption for all communications.
- Bitrix24 stores data in EU and US data centers with backup options.
Always read the privacy policy and understand where your data is stored.
User Access and Permissions
Even on free plans, role-based access control helps protect sensitive information. While some free versions lack advanced permissions, others offer basic controls.
- Zoho CRM allows admin and user roles in the free plan.
- HubSpot lets you control dashboard visibility.
- Bitrix24 offers detailed permission settings even in free tier.
Limit access to financial or personal data to trusted team members only.

What is the best free CRM for small businesses?
The best free CRM for small businesses depends on your needs. HubSpot CRM is ideal for sales-focused teams, Zoho CRM for automation, and Bitrix24 for all-in-one functionality. Evaluate based on user count, features, and integration needs.
Can I use a free CRM for a growing business?
Yes, many free CRMs scale well. Platforms like HubSpot and Zoho offer seamless upgrades to paid plans. Start with a free version to test the system, then upgrade as your team or data grows.
Are free CRM tools secure?
Most reputable free CRM tools use strong encryption and comply with data protection laws. However, always review the provider’s security policy and avoid storing highly sensitive data unless necessary.
Do free CRMs include customer support?
Support varies. HubSpot offers email and community support on its free plan. Zoho provides help center access and ticketing. Some platforms like Bitrix24 offer live chat even in free tiers.
How do I migrate data from one CRM to another?
Most CRMs allow CSV import/export. Use this to transfer contacts and deals. Tools like Zapier or automated migration services can help with complex data. Always back up your data before switching.
